16 Muslim Uyghurs arrested for illegal entry

Pattaya Mail, 27 April 2014

SA KAEO, April 25 – Thai border authorities today arrested 16 Uyghurs Muslims as they tried to illegally enter Thailand. Sa Kaeo Deputy Immigration Police Commissioner Pol Lt Col Benjapon Rodsawas said a combined force of immigration police and army patrolled a Cambodian border zone this morning and intercepted a pickup truck which looked suspicious in Aranyaprathet-Khao Chakan Road in Wattana Nakhon district.

Inspecting the vehicle, security personnel found 16 illegal immigrants, including children. All were later taken for questioning at an army checkpoint.

Although the detainees have no travel or national identity documents, investigators initially believe that they are members of the Uyghur Muslim minority and were destined for Malaysia.

Police said they will be charged with illegal entry to the kingdom.
